Braille Note Evolve demo 5 - using Braille on the Braille Note Evolve
In this demo, I explain how to choose your preferred reading input and output table, and then have a bit of a play around with the Braille Editor, and Word.

Braille Note Evolve demo 4 - a quick review of Quick Settings, and then handy KeySoft, NVDA, and Window commands
Along with mentioning the KeySoft Options menu, KeySoft Control Centre, and the NvDA categories screen (also accessed via the Options menu), before getting on to the handy keyboard commands, I give you a quick run through of the Quick Settings screen. handy keyboard commands Stop speech BackSpace Enter great if modifier keys disabled or Control. If in computer Braille: add space to commands. Backspace: Backspace (key 7.Enter: Enter (key 8).Escape: Escape key.Delete: delete key.Move cursor to item on Braille display: auto cursor buttons.Arrow keys: Left, Right, Up, and Down.Thumb keys (left to right: Previous, Pan previous, Home, Pan next, Next. Keyboard help: BackSpace+Space+K. Numbers: FN+computer braille numbers 1 to 0.Function keys: FN+letters a to l. Time: NVDA+FN+l or Enteer+t.Date: NVDA+FN+l (twice).Power: Enter+p. Window title: NVDA+t.Read all controls in window: NVDA+b.Read continuously: NVDA+a.Toggle Braille: BackSpace+Space+g.Toggle speech: NVDA+s. Braille keyboard input navigation Previous/next character: Space+3-6.Previous/next word; Space+2-5.Previous line: Space+1-4. Quit app: Alt+F4: Space-E or FN+Alt+d.Context menu: Space+M or FN+Shift+j.Previous/Next tab: Space+12-45.Home/End: Enter+13-46.Top/bottom: 123-456. Keyboard input Previous/next character: Left-Right arrow.Previous/next word: Control+Left-Right arrow.Previous/next line: UpDdown arrow. NVDA NVDA: NVDA+n.Quit NVDA: NVDA+q.FN+t: Standard/Perkins keyboard toggle. Windows Keys: Desktop: Win+d.Minimise to desktop: Win+m.Task bar: Win+t.System tray: Win+b.Settings: Win+i.Run: Win+r.Explorer: Win+e.Narrator: Control+Win+Enter. FN+t: toggle between standard and Perkins keyboard.
